Hospitalisation is a form of healthcare provided to individuals who, after admission to a healthcare establishment, occupy a bed (or neonatal or paediatric cot) for diagnosis, treatment or palliative care, with a stay of at least 24 hours.

Hospitalisation can be configured as scheduled surgical, urgent surgical or medical.
